Understanding the Types of Coffee Machines

Before we dive into the costs associated with coffee machines, it’s essential to understand the different types available. Each type of machine is designed to cater to specific needs and budgets, so it’s crucial to choose the one that best suits your cafe’s requirements.

Drip Coffee Machines

Drip coffee machines are one of the most common types found in cafes. They are relatively affordable, easy to use, and can produce large quantities of coffee quickly. These machines are ideal for high-volume cafes that need to serve a large number of customers during peak hours. Drip coffee machines can range in price from $500 to $2,000, depending on the brand, quality, and features.

Espresso Machines

Espresso machines are a staple in any serious cafe. They are designed to produce high-quality espresso shots, which are the foundation of many popular coffee drinks. Espresso machines can be further divided into two categories: semi-automatic and automatic. Semi-automatic machines require a barista to manually control the brewing process, while automatic machines can produce espresso shots with the touch of a button. Espresso machines can range in price from $2,000 to $10,000, depending on the type, brand, and features.

Pod Coffee Machines

Pod coffee machines, also known as single-serve coffee machines, use individual coffee pods to produce a variety of coffee drinks. These machines are convenient, easy to use, and require minimal maintenance. However, they can be more expensive to operate in the long run due to the cost of coffee pods. Pod coffee machines can range in price from $100 to $1,000, depending on the brand and features.

Cold Brew Coffee Machines

Cold brew coffee machines are designed to produce high-quality cold brew coffee, which has become increasingly popular in recent years. These machines use a unique brewing process that involves steeping coarse-ground coffee beans in cold water for an extended period. Cold brew coffee machines can range in price from $500 to $2,000, depending on the brand and features.

Factors Affecting Coffee Machine Costs

When it comes to determining the cost of a coffee machine, there are several factors to consider. These factors can significantly impact the overall price of the machine, so it’s essential to understand them before making a purchase.

Brand and Quality

The brand and quality of the coffee machine can greatly impact its price. High-end brands like La Marzocco and Synesso can range in price from $5,000 to $10,000, while more affordable brands like Breville and De’Longhi can range in price from $500 to $2,000.

Features and Capabilities

The features and capabilities of the coffee machine can also impact its price. Machines with advanced features like automatic grinding, temperature control, and milk frothing can be more expensive than basic machines. Additional features can add $1,000 to $2,000 to the overall cost of the machine.

Size and Capacity

The size and capacity of the coffee machine can also affect its price. Larger machines with higher capacities can be more expensive than smaller machines. Machines with multiple group heads can range in price from $5,000 to $10,000, while smaller machines with single group heads can range in price from $2,000 to $5,000.

Additional Costs to Consider

When budgeting for a coffee machine, it’s essential to consider additional costs that can impact the overall expense. These costs can include maintenance, repairs, and accessories.

Maintenance and Repairs

Regular maintenance and repairs can help extend the life of the coffee machine and prevent costly breakdowns. Maintenance costs can range from $500 to $1,000 per year, depending on the type and usage of the machine.

Accessories and Supplies

Additional accessories and supplies, such as coffee beans, filters, and cleaning solutions, can also impact the overall cost of the coffee machine. These costs can range from $500 to $1,000 per month, depending on the type and quantity of supplies needed.
